Understanding the Basics

The bucket hat first emerged in the early 20th century as functional headwear. Traditional styles are made from materials like cotton or denim and provide sun protection and comfort. On the other hand, the transparent bucket hat, a more recent trend, is crafted from synthetic materials that offer a completely different aesthetic and functionality.

Key Differences: Materials and Benefits

Material Composition

Traditional bucket hats are generally made from breathable fabrics that offer comfort and durability. Common materials include:

  • Cotton: Soft and breathable.
  • Denim: Durable with a classic texture.
  • Canvas: Sturdy and suitable for outdoor usage.

In contrast, transparent bucket hats are often made from PVC or clear vinyl. These materials are lightweight but lack breathability, making them ideal for light rain or as fashion statements rather than for long outdoor use.

Visual and Functional Appeal

Transparent bucket hats serve a unique function. They are often seen as a fashion accessory that adds a modern twist to any outfit. Their visibility allows the wearer’s hairstyle or other headwear to shine through, making them more versatile for those looking to make a statement.

Traditional bucket hats, meanwhile, offer a classic look and can be easily paired with various outfits, from casual to semi-formal. Their classic fabric choices often lead them to be more widely accepted in various settings.

The Price Factor

Pricing varies significantly between the two styles. Traditional bucket hats range from $15 to $60, depending on brand and material. Transparent bucket hats generally fall in a similar price range, but fashion-forward designers can price them up to $120. This price disparity often reflects the novelty and design elements of the transparent versions.
